How much do associate full stack develop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average hourly pay for associate full stack developer in Little Rock, AR is $56.84,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$47.26 and $65.48 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an associate full stack developer?

An Associate Full Stack Developer is an entry-level role responsible for working on both front-end and back-end development tasks. They assist in designing, coding, testing, and maintaining web applications, often using languages like JavaScript, Python, or Java. They collaborate with senior developers and teams to build responsive, scalable, and functional software. This role helps gain hands-on experience in databases, APIs, and frameworks while improving coding and problem-solving skills. It serves as a foundation for advancing to more senior development positions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ate full stack developer?

To thrive as an Associate Full Stack Developer, you need a solid understanding of both front-end and back-end development languages and frameworks, such as JavaScript, HTML/CSS, and server-side technologies like Node.js or Python, often demonstrated by a relevant degree or coding bootcamp certificate.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, cloud platforms, and databases is typically required, and certifications from platforms like AWS or Microsoft Azure can be be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, effective communication, and the ability to work collaboratively in agile teams help set candidates apart. These combined skills are crucial for delivering high-quality, integrated software solutions that meet user and business needs.

What are typical career growth opportunities for an associate full stack developer?

As an Associate Full Stack Developer, you'll gain broad exposure to both front-end and back-end technologies, positioning you for advancement to mid-level or senior developer roles. With experience, you might also branch into specialized areas such as DevOps, cloud engineering, or software architecture. Many employers offer mentorship programs, training resources, and opportunities to work on diverse projects to accelerate your professional growth. Demonstrating initiative and expanding your skill set can lead to roles with greater responsibility, such as Team Lead or Technical Project Manager.

Is an associate full stack developer still in demand?

Yes, associate full stack developers are in demand due to the ongoing need for versatile software developers skilled in both front-end and back-end technologies. Employers value these roles for their ability to contribute across multiple areas of development, especially with proficiency in frameworks like React, Node.js, and cloud platforms. The demand is expected to remain strong as companies continue to prioritize digital transformation and full-stack expertise.

Responsibilities

Essential Functions:

The Sales Development Rep-2 (SDR-2) is responsible for executing on initial steps associated with the sales process. After successful completion of an extensive 10- week hands on training that includes online learning, business role plays and real time sales scenarios, the SDR will:

Research and build call sheets of targeted customers in the market by leveraging tools like Linked In and resources including Candidates and current Consultants Document, track and research all leads coming in from Recruiter Lead Program Build overall customer profiles based on information learned and talk tracks for each customer by using tools like Seismic and Gong Perform outreach to targeted customer list and document weekly activity Partner with Director of Business Operations on using the Inward Lens tool to identify lost customers in order to build call sheets to generate new meetings.

Success in the SDR-2 Role will lead to promotion to Account Manager where additional responsibilities will include: Develop and manage new and existing customer relationships by leveraging resources including but not limited to Salesforce and Hoovers Increase sales and market share through assigned and newly generated accounts Contact and meet with prospective customers to establish customer needs, hiring cycles, and build a customer intimate relationship Prepare and present sales information and effective proposals for customers Partner with Delivery team in identifying top IT Talent to fulfill client needs
